Clinically meaningful weight loss, defined as a reduction of 5% in baseline BW, was achieved by 73.2%92.4% of semaglutide-treated participants, compared with 21.4%50.0% in the placebo arms [13, 38,39,40,41,42,43,44,45,46]
1 Bottom Line Semaglutide may result in more weight loss than other currently available treatments, but many patients will experience gastrointestinal effects and may regain a portion of the weight lost if the medication is discontinued
